Oracle Cerner is excited to hire a Network Engineer I. As a Network Engineer I, you will be responsible to design, support, install, and maintain local area network, wide area network, and wireless network components. You will be responsible to work on and maintain hardware components, including firewalls, load balancers, routers, switches and access points. You will be responsible to troubleshoot network connectivity issues. You will be responsible to perform project work to update or replace network equipment. You will be responsible to configure or upgrade network components. You will also be responsible to complete assigned incident management tasks.

Qualifications
Basic Qualifications:
At least 4 years total combined related work experience and completed higher education, including:
Bachelor\'s degree in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Information Systems, Software Engineering, or related field, or equivalent relevant work experience
Preferred Qualifications:
Certified Wireless Network Administrator (CWNA) - CWNP
Cisco Certified Design Associate (CCDA) - Cisco
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) - Cisco
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) Wireless - Cisco
Expectations:
May be required to lift up to 20 lbs., i.e. server, network equipment
Perform other responsibilities as assigned
Willing to travel up to 20% as needed
Willing to work additional or irregular hours as needed and allowed by local regulations
Work in accordance with corporate and organizational security policies and procedures, understand personal role in safeguarding corporate and client assets and take appropriate action to prevent and report any compromises of security within the scope of the position
